Swapping engines maybe physically ok but there are different coding in ecu's. The BPY is used in 19 different VAG models e.g.

Manufacturer: VW, Date(s) Used: 05/2008-11/2010, Model: Eos, Engine Code: BPY, 147Kw, 200PS, 2.0 Ltr, 4 Cyls, Remarks: North American Region (NAR), Canada ("CDN"), South Korea ("ROK"), USA ("USA")
Manufacturer: VW, Date(s) Used: 05/2007-02/2009, Model: Golf, Engine Code: BPY, 147Kw, 200PS, 2.0 Ltr, 4 Cyls, Remarks: Canada ("CDN"), USA ("USA")
Manufacturer: VW, Date(s) Used: 05/2005-11/2008, Model: Golf/Variant/4Motion/R32, Engine Code: BPY, 147Kw, 200PS, 2.0 Ltr, 4 Cyls, Remarks: R32
